About Samantha
Samantha is an Associate on BOYNECLARKE LLP's Family Law team. Before law school, she spent more than ten years in customer service and client-facing roles, which shapes her empathetic approach to family law matters. Samantha earned her Juris Doctor from the Schulich School of Law at Dalhousie University in 2022 and a Bachelor of Business Administration with First Class Honours from the University of New Brunswick in 2018. She's a member of the Nova Scotia Barristers' Society and the Association of Family and Conciliation Courts, and volunteers on the board of Alice House.
